  • Twenty-six-year-old Buster Murdaugh testified in his father's double murder trial. His dad, Alex Murdaugh, is accused of fatally shooting his wife, Maggie, and his 22-year-old son Paul. During his testimony, Buster recalled the night his father called with the terrible news that his mom and brother were shot to death. He’s a key witness for the defense and portrayed the Murdaughs as a loving family while intimate photos were shown to the jury.
